Shear Bond Strength of a New Bioactive Luting Cement on a CAD/CAM High-Density Hybrid Composite Material

Abstract

None of the current commercially available cements meet the all of the desired criterion of luting agents. Purpose. This investigation evaluated the shear bond strength of a hybrid luting cement made of calcium-aluminate/glass ionomer (CA/GI) applied to a composite CAD/CAM block.
